Launched in January 2026, the Smart variant starts at ₹5.59 Lakh (ex-showroom) and is available in both Petrol and iCNG options.
Petrol : ₹5.59L
iCNG : ₹6.69L
| Engine | 1.2L Revotron Petrol (88 PS / 115 Nm) |
| Transmission | 5-Speed Manual
Key Highlights of the Smart Variant
1. Major Safety Upgrade (Standard)
Perhaps the biggest change is the inclusion of premium safety features as standard across the range, including the Smart trim:
* **6 Airbags: Now standard from the base model.
* Electronic Stability Program (ESP): To maintain control during sudden maneuvers.
* Hill Hold Assist: Prevents the car from rolling back on inclines.
* iTPMS: Intelligent Tyre Pressure Monitoring System.
* ISOFIX: Child seat anchor points.
* Remote central locking
2. Refreshed Exterior
The Smart variant benefits from the facelift’s modern "PowerSight" design language:
* LED Headlamps: Vertically stacked units that give the car a more aggressive look.
* Revised Fascia: A new 3D-effect grille and updated front and rear bumpers.
* 15-inch Wheels: Steel wheels with a sturdy appearance.
* Follow-me-home Headlamps: A convenience feature usually reserved for higher trims.
3. Modernized Interior
While it lacks the large 10.25-inch screen of the top trims, the cabin still feels updated:
* Digital Instrument Cluster: Features a 10.16 cm (4-inch) digital display for essential driving data.
* New Steering Wheel: Adopts the new two-spoke design seen in newer Tata models.
* Multi-Drive Modes: Choice between Eco and City modes to balance fuel efficiency and performance.
